Managing your energy consumption in Termina can be a daunting task, especially when you're trying to stay within budget. But don't worry! With a little planning and some savvy choices, you can reduce your energy bill without neglecting your quality of life.

  • Firstly, it's essential to carry out a in-depth energy audit of your home. This will help you in pinpointing areas where you can make improvements.
  • Secondly, consider upgrading your appliances to more cost-effective models. Look for the Energy Star label, which indicates that a product meets strict energy-saving guidelines.
  • , In conclusion, incorporate some simple habitual changes to substantially reduce your energy consumption. These comprise things like turning off lights when you leave a room, unplugging electronics when not in use, and regulating your thermostat.
